Status of Spanish Regulations and Industry Actions Related to Filtered Containment Vent Systems

Description

After the Fukushima Daiichi nuclear power plant accident on March 11, 2011, the European Union launched a plan in order to analyse the capacity of nuclear power plants in the member countries to manage a similar situation. This plan was called ''stress tests'' and its objectives were to assess the ability of European nuclear power plants in operation to handle situations beyond their design basis, while identifying the existing margins and the possible measures to improve the managing of the postulated situations. Western European Nuclear Regulators Association (WENRA) drafted a proposal for the "stress tests" which was approved by the European Nuclear Safety Regulators Group (ENSREG) and distributed to the member countries for its implementation. The provisions included at the ENSREG's document were required to the Spanish nuclear power plants by the Spanish Nuclear Safety Council (CSN) through Complementary Technical Instructions (ITC). CSN, after evaluating the facilities' stress tests reports, required the installation of Filtered Containment Venting Systems (FCVS), in agreement to the operators' conclusions. FCVS will be installed in all Spanish nuclear power plants by the end of 2017.
